Pulmonary embolism
Hello Doctor, This is for my mother , 70 years old. History of frontal ICH on 19th August 2020. Recovered well with conservative line of treatment and has good response in all her limbs and cognitive functionality. She has been diagnosed with Pulmonary embolism and DVT recently. For DVT in femoral vein, IVC filter is suggested and we are okay with it. Need suggestion on should clot dissolving drugs (dabigatran 150) should be administered for PE , given her one month old episode  of ICH? Attached is the clinical summary and ct Angio lungs. Please guide.

The management of pulmonary embolism depends upon clinical scenerio. Hemodynamically unstble patient require urgent fibrinolysis while some require anticoagulant and another few require filter
